簡介
本模組探討 GitHub Copilot 的功能與能力。 你將檢視 GitHub Copilot 從 GitHub 提供的產品,並檢視 GitHub Copilot 的優點、帳號類型、功能與限制。 完成 Visual Studio Code GitHub Copilot 擴充功能的逐步安裝後,您將檢視 GitHub Copilot 與 GitHub Copilot Chat 擴充功能所提供的功能。 你還會完成一個示範如何在 Visual Studio Code 中配置 GitHub Copilot 擴充套件的練習。
假設您是科技新創公司的軟體開發人員。 您負責開發公司其中一個最新應用程式的功能。 您很高興獲得指派,但期限很緊迫。 您還沒有看到程式碼基底,而且需要確保新功能無錯誤 (bug) 且有效率。 你聽說 GitHub Copilot 可以加速你的開發流程,所以你很期待自己去體驗它的新功能。 GitHub Copilot 可以解釋新的複雜程式碼、產生文件,並協助你更有效率、更準確地開發程式碼。 GitHub Copilot 能協助你趕上截止期限,並為團隊提供高品質的功能。
此課程模組中所涵蓋的主題包括:
- 探索來自 GitHub、OpenAI 和 Microsoft 的開發者 AI 工具。
- 檢視 GitHub Copilot 的計畫、工具、功能與限制。
- 設定、配置及管理 GitHub Copilot for Visual Studio Code。
- 檢視 GitHub Copilot 的程式碼完成功能。
- 檢視 GitHub Copilot 的 AI 協助功能。
在本單元結束時,你將能描述 GitHub Copilot 如何提升你的生產力、減少錯誤,並使軟體開發流程更有效率。
重要
要完成此 GitHub Copilot 培訓,您必須在個人 GitHub 帳號中擁有有效的 GitHub Copilot 訂閱(包含 GitHub Copilot 免費方案),或必須被指派至由組織或企業管理的訂閱。 模組活動可能包含 GitHub Copilot 的建議,這些建議與公開代碼相符。 如果你是 GitHub Enterprise Cloud 組織的成員,且透過你的組織被指派了 GitHub Copilot 訂閱,與公開程式碼相符的建議設定可能會繼承自你的組織或企業。 如果您的帳戶封鎖符合公用程式代碼的建議,模組活動可能無法如預期般運作。